Dynamics CRM 2013 and 2015 Installation Notes: SSRS

I ran into a couple of things while performing a fresh on-premise installations of Dynamics CRM 2013 and 2015 that I wanted to capture.

 

Service Credentials

Dynamics CRM 2015 does not like it when the SSRS service, SQL Server Reporting Services (MSSQLSERVER), is running under a local user account so I had to change the credentials to that of a domain user.
